Developing legible handwriting is a foundational skill, crucial for effective communication and academic success. A resource dedicated to mastering a specific character within the alphabet offers a focused approach to improving penmanship. This particular focus ensures that learners can dedicate their attention to perfecting the unique shape and formation of a challenging letter.

The consistent practice provided by such a learning tool yields several key advantages. It strengthens fine motor skills, essential for handwriting proficiency. Repetitive tracing and writing exercises engrain the proper muscle memory, leading to improved letter formation and consistency. Moreover, targeted practice bolsters confidence in writing abilities, encouraging more fluent and expressive written communication.

A typical worksheet designed for this purpose often features a variety of exercises. These may include tracing exercises, where the learner follows dotted lines to form the letter. Another type of activity involves independent writing of the letter within designated spaces, allowing for self-assessment and refinement. The format often includes both uppercase and lowercase versions of the letter, further solidifying understanding.

To maximize the benefits, a structured approach is recommended. Begin by carefully studying the correct formation of the letter, paying close attention to the starting point and stroke direction. Trace the letter multiple times, focusing on maintaining consistent pressure and smooth lines. Gradually transition to writing the letter independently, comparing each attempt to the model for accuracy. Regular, short practice sessions are more effective than infrequent, lengthy ones.
